The Icee ejector arm stopped turning due to icecube jam.
Not being a professional repair tech, I looked at this sites provided schematics of the ice-maker. I assumed due to the problem I had which parts to order. the parts arrived within 3 days and after I took the icemaker apart I quickly realized I ordered the wrong parts. I called and asked what to do. since I did not open the packaging for the "wrong" parts I was able to make a return. I then called back because I discoverd the part I really needed wasn't shown in the sketch. I was told that I needed to order a new motor and it would have the part I needed. I ordered the part and within 3 days it arrived. Once I had the new part I was able to quickly install. Now I have a icemaker that works better than new since ,now it does not seem to jam either.
To make the repair:
First remove the 1/4" nut head screw on the under side of the ice maker.
Remove the shroud covering the electrical connection.
Slide out the maker and depress the locking clip.
Disconect the electrical wires.
Pull off the motor cover (no screws).
Remove the three philips head screws from the motor housing. Gently remove the motor.
Next loosen the screws and pull the "black motor-mounting harness" untill enough clearance to remove the ejector arm and deflector tray. The new kit will have a new ejector arm and deflector tray.
Insallation is the reverse.

Ice crusher not dispensing crushing ice or dispensing ice cubes
1. Remove the ice box
2. Unscrew the two Phillips screws on the base of the ice box compartment
3. Lift up the coupling and shaft (be careful because there is a spring between shaft and coupling and washer)
4. Remove old coupling
5. Replace with new coupling and remember to put back the spring
6. Insert back shaft with coupling and washer
7. Screw back on the Phillips screws
8. Replace back the icebox

Ice maker leaked into ice reservoir
The ice mold has a coating on it. Over time the coating deteriorates. If your ice maker leaks water into the ice reservoir inspect the mold to see if the coating is compromised. If so, replace with new.
Remove the ice maker assembly. 3 small hex screws. Unplug power cord. Disassemble ice maker assembly. Remove ice mold/heater. Replace with new. Reassemble.

Ice and water pads hard to use and ice kept spurting out
Remove ice drip tray to expose two phillips screws.
Remove screws
Pull out slightly and push up to detach at top. Move carefully to the right and expose electrics. Disconnect white connector carefully pushing on tab . Disconnect two pads black connectors in similar manner.
Remove ice maker panel. Remove pads from back by carefully pushing on tabs use a small flat head srew driver to push gently down and up and away from panel. Remove wire from white tape . Install the new pads by the reverse of removal. Carefully make sure wires are not pinched in electric unit on water side. Reconnect small black connectors and white power connector. Reinstall panel and insert screws. Replace ice drip tray. Viola complete

Black flecks in ice
The lining of the ice mold (Whirlpool) started flecking off (black flecks in the ice cubes), so I decided to replace the mold.
Loosen the two 1/4 inch upper nuts and remove the lower nut to remove the ice maker from the freezer. The hardest part was getting it unplugged. I used a small blade screwdriver to release the catch on the connector and pull it out.
Remove the ice maker front cover. If you have a skinny enough phillips screw driver, there are two deep set screws through two holes on the lower portion of the control module (otherwise, remove the three screws on the controller, unlatch the shut-off arm from the control module, and separate the controller to access the mold screws). Unhook the shut-off wire from the end of the tray. Unscrew the two screws holding the mold and remove the mold.
Remove the plastic hardware from the old mold and install on the new mold.
Attach the new mold on to the control module.
WARNING WARNING WARNING!!! The mold I bought already had the alumilastic on it for the contact point to the thermostat. When I installed it and tightened the screws, the alumilastic was dried out, didn't squash down, and dented the bi-metal thermostat on the controller, ruining it. I had to buy a new thermostat. Be sure to check that the alumilastic is pliable. If not, take it off and buy some fresh to put on there.
Re-install the ice maker. It took a while to get the first batch of ice because the ice maker was at room temperature and I had the freezer door open for several minutes. So the freezer had to get cold and the ice maker had to chill down. Once everything got cold, it started making ice again.
